AR19, a manipulation-resistant formulation of amphetamine sulfate, was created to address the problem of non-oral use of stimulant medications (eg, smoking, injecting). In this video, Dr Faraone highlights the findings and implications of a recent randomized controlled trial of AR19 in adult ADHD.
